Clemente Paul Pena

May 12, 1973 — September 11, 2021

Clemente Paul Pena was born on May 12, 1973, in Saginaw, Michigan and passed away at age of 48.
He was the beloved son of Rachel Pena Hugare.

Paul loved art since he was a little boy, as he got older, he expressed himself through his paintings. When he was a young boy, he enjoyed playing baseball, kickball, climbing trees, bowling and watching The Comedy Classic – The Three Stooges with his cousins. Paul was born and raised in Saginaw but when he was 11 years old, he moved to Chicago with his mother and went back and forth from Saginaw to Chicago until he was 17 years old. He loved listening to “House Music” and making tamales.

Our grandma’s house was always full of love and family. Everyone knows that Paul was grandma’s favorite and she was his too. Paul loved, cherished and adored his grandmother very much. Each year he would send his mom cards for Mother’s Day, Christmas and her Birthday, he never missed a year. Paul was a wonderful son, brother and uncle.

Many of you may not have known the mature intelligent man that Paul became but Paul’s greatest achievement of 2021, despite having cancer, graduated with honors 4.0 GPA at Mott Community College – Associates Degree. One of Paul’s teachers at Mott said, “He was universally acclaimed by instructors and was a huge positive force amongst his peers.”

Paul was known for being a genuine person, his beautiful smile, charming ways, intelligence, loyalty, courage, strong will, love and compassion for people. Paul had great faith in God all the way until his last breath. Paul was loved and respected very much and survived by his stepfather and mother, Tom and Rachel Hugare; sister, Mia Pena; brothers, Jesse Betancourt, Juan Olivarez, Tom Jr. and Daniel Hugare; many nieces, nephews, aunts, cousins including Jeana Favela and Sophia Pena who were raised as sisters; favorite cousins Augie and Marcella, best friend/brother Manuel Rivera and many friends, teachers, doctors, and nurses. Anyone that came in touch with Paul just grew to love and care for him because of the beautiful person that he was. He will be deeply missed by everyone.

Paul was preceded in death by grandparents, Antonio and Mary Pena; uncles, Antonio and John Pena, Jerry Delgado, Robert Menzel; aunt, Catherine Teneyuque and cousins Eva Ortega, Arturo and Johnny Pena.

Special thanks to Mary McDonald at Paradise Funeral Chapel for her kindness. Dr. Gina Couturier and Dr. Heidi Doran from TCF and Mott Community College.
